13. [TNSCOTT] Free Lookup--"Marriage Index: IL, IN, KY, OH, and TN, 1720-1926" [1]
>From Ancestral Findings: "Marriage Index: IL, IN, KY, OH, and TN, 1720-1926" =========================================================== This database contains indexes to marriage records for selected years from 221 selected counties in five states: Illinois (19), Indiana (51), Kentucky (67), Ohio (39), and Tennessee (45).
